Summary
A vulnerability, which was classified as problematic, has been found in Sanjeev Mohindra Awesome Shortcodes for Genesis Plugin up to .8 on WordPress. This affects an unknown part. This manipulation causes cross-site request forgery. This vulnerability is registered as CVE-2024-51638. Remote exploitation of the attack is possible. No exploit is available.
Details
A vulnerability classified as problematic was found in Sanjeev Mohindra Awesome Shortcodes for Genesis Plugin up to .8 on WordPress. Affected by this vulnerability is an unknown functionality.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a cross-site request forgery v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-352. The web application does not, or can not, sufficiently verify whether a well-formed, valid, consistent request was intentionally provided by the user who submitted the request. As an impact it is known to affect integrity. The summary by CVE is:
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F) vulnerability in Sanjeev Mohindra Awesome Shortcodes For Genesis allows Stored XSS.This issue affects Awesome Shortcodes For Genesis: from n/a through .8.
The weakness was published by Soprobro. The advisory is shared at patchstack.com. This vulnerability is known as CVE-2024-51638 since 10/30/2024. The exploitation appears to be easy. The attack can be launched remotely. The exploitation doesn't need any form of authentication. It demands that the victim is doing some kind of user interaction. Neither technical details nor an exploit are publicly available.
There is no information about possible countermeasures known. It may be suggested to replace the affected object with an alternative product.
